Output 285db5774f94bdbf89856694106cef7ac8e0bacaf6728e9717a9c0a9264723e2:3

value
305849007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999cbb464e16122538068e09e989449ed4a0f4b7 OP_EQUAL
address
3FhF4nuJNBoXQ7krUpMGJq5De2zpxw3yeg
transaction
285db5774f94bdbf89856694106cef7ac8e0bacaf6728e9717a9c0a9264723e2
confirmations
487376
spent
true